I have observed an occasional crash in tmux 1.8 when I change the font size
of
the terminal window.  I haven't been able to determine a good set of
reproduce
steps yet, but I'll try some more later.  In the meantime, here is a stack
trace:

#0  0x0000000000430ca0 in screen_write_linefeed (ctx=0x2229778, wrapped=0)
at screen-write.c:877
#1  0x00000000004222b3 in input_c0_dispatch (ictx=0x2229770) at input.c:965
#2  0x0000000000421c90 in input_parse (wp=0x2229660) at input.c:781
#3  0x0000000000453a6c in window_pane_read_callback (bufev=0x2214770,
data=0x2229660) at window.c:879
#4  0x00007f8feb31d3cd in bufferevent_readcb () from
/usr/lib64/libevent-2.0.so.5
#5  0x00007f8feb312c0c in event_base_loop () from
/usr/lib64/libevent-2.0.so.5
#6  0x0000000000437101 in server_loop () at server.c:207
#7  0x00000000004370e5 in server_start (lockfd=6, lockfile=0x21d2dd0
"\001") at server.c:198
#8  0x000000000040505e in client_connect (path=0x690760 <socket_path>
"/tmp/tmux-1000/default", start_server=1) at client.c:124
#9  0x000000000040529f in client_main (argc=0, argv=0x7fffcb070670,
flags=1) at client.c:221
#10 0x00000000004414e4 in main (argc=0, argv=0x7fffcb070670) at tmux.c:406

Through adding some asserts, I believe I have narrowed it down to
screen_reflow().  In particular, s->cy becomes -1 and wraps.  I added a
hack
to ensure s->cy doesn't become negative, and I have not been able to
reproduce
the crash since.
